Answered step by step
Verified Expert Solution
Link Copied!

Question

1 Approved Answer

Create a class Deque and implement the functions of double ended queue. All functions should run in O(1). Write a function InsertRear that inserts an

  1. Create a class Deque and implement the functions of double ended queue. All functions should run in O(1).

  1. Write a function InsertRear that inserts an element at the rear of the Deque.
  2. Write a function GetRear that returns the last item from the Deque.
  3. Write a function DeleteRear that removes an item from the rear of Deque.

class Deque:

def __init__(self):

// your code goes here

def InsertRear(self,value):

// your code goes here

def GetRear(self):

// your code goes here

def DeleteRear(self):

// your code goes here

python

Step by Step Solution

There are 3 Steps involved in it

Step: 1

blur-text-image

Get Instant Access to Expert-Tailored Solutions

See step-by-step solutions with expert insights and AI powered tools for academic success

Step: 2

blur-text-image

Step: 3

blur-text-image

Ace Your Homework with AI

Get the answers you need in no time with our AI-driven, step-by-step assistance

Get Started

Recommended Textbook for

Advanced MySQL 8 Discover The Full Potential Of MySQL And Ensure High Performance Of Your Database

Authors: Eric Vanier ,Birju Shah ,Tejaswi Malepati

1st Edition

1788834445, 978-1788834445

More Books

Students also viewed these Databases questions

Question

Repeat (a) and (b) of Exercise 2.57 for the data set 8.

Answered: 1 week ago

Question

Compare levels of resolution in conflict outcomes?

Answered: 1 week ago

Question

Strategies for Managing Conflict Conflict Outcomes?

Answered: 1 week ago